Cultural Significance

In the culture where the Maneki Neko originated, it is primarily a charm for good luck and financial success, often displayed in shops or homes. Unlike Western lucky symbols that might focus on chance or destiny, this cat actively 'beckons' fortune through its gesture, emphasizing invitation and engagement. In contrast, some other East Asian cultures associate similar figures with protection and spiritual warding as much as luck. In popular culture beyond its roots, the Maneki Neko has become a fusion symbol mixing commerce with friendly folklore, making it a cross-cultural icon of optimism and welcome.
